NHL: Los Angeles 3, Dallas 2

|
 
Published: March. 31, 2013 at 8:56 PM

DALLAS, March 31 (UPI) -- Brad Richardson and Justin Williams each scored in the third period Sunday for the Los Angeles Kings, who hung on for a 3-2 win over Dallas.

Richardson's first of the year 5:40 into the final frame broke a 1-1 tie and Williams' tally only 69 seconds later iced it for the Kings, who outshot Dallas 40-15 and en route to their third win in four contests.

Jeff Carter potted his 20th of the season and Jonathan Bernier made 13 saves for Los Angeles, which holds the fourth seed in the Western Conference.

Jamie Benn and Ray Whitney scored for the Stars, who came into the contest one point out of the West's eighth and final post-season slot.

Kari Lehtonen made 37 saves for Dallas.
